The Laminar Flow Hood is a type of laboratory equipment used to protect samples from contamination. It is a type of enclosed bench or cabinet with a fan and filter system that creates a stream of air that is free of contaminants. The air is drawn in from the top of the hood and passes through a filter before being released from the front of the hood. This creates a clean, sterile environment for the user to work in. The hood is typically used in medical, pharmaceutical, and industrial laboratories to protect samples from contamination.
